WRT to 16-bit PNGs ..."you can force use SCIFIO via File > Import > Image...
(way at the bottom of the menu!"

Yes nice, I tried this from the menu and it worked ... I turned OFF both SCIFIO
and IJ2 structs and Fiji presented the image in full 16-bit, as though both
options were ON.  The same 10s delay takes place but it worked.  I got excited
because this looked like a good solution for both the many 1-second JPGs and
the hi-res solitary PNG as needed, but alas, macro record emitted only this
line:
   run("Image... ")
without file information or other parameters in the window.  It's as though the
macro script is incomplete for the command???
